Comprehending Assisted Living: What It Is and Who It Serves
Assisted living offers as an important resource for individuals who require support with day-to-day tasks while preserving a level of self-reliance. This kind of living setup provides mainly to senior citizens or those with handicaps that may battle with jobs such as bathing, clothing, or drug management. Citizens take advantage of personalized help customized to their details requirements, permitting them to take part in social activities and keep a form of freedom. Assisted living centers commonly offer a risk-free environment geared up with experienced personnel readily available around the clock. This setup cultivates a feeling of community, which can considerably enhance emotional wellness. Ultimately, helped living aims to strike a balance between assistance and independence, ensuring that people can lead satisfying lives while obtaining essential care.
Types of Assisted Living Facilities
What alternatives are offered for those looking for assisted living? Numerous kinds of nursing home provide to different needs and preferences. Conventional assisted living neighborhoods offer housing, dishes, and assistance with everyday activities, advertising self-reliance while guaranteeing security. Memory care facilities focus on services for people with Alzheimer's or dementia, supplying customized programs and secure atmospheres. Proceeding care retired life neighborhoods integrate independent living, helped living, and competent nursing treatment, enabling homeowners to move as their demands transform. Furthermore, little group homes supply a more intimate setup, emphasizing individualized treatment and neighborhood involvement (Assisted Living Charlotte NC). Each kind of facility aims to boost the lifestyle for locals while offering differing levels useful and social communication

Financial Considerations and Funding Options
While checking out assisted living individuals, alternatives and families frequently encounter considerable monetary considerations that can significantly influence their options. The price of assisted living differs commonly based on area, amenities, and level of treatment required. It is vital to evaluate individual budgets and explore numerous funding resources. Lots of families use personal cost savings, pension plans, or long-lasting treatment insurance coverage to cover expenditures. In addition, experts may get advantages through the VA, while some states offer assistance programs that can help reduce costs. Comprehending these monetary dynamics is necessary for making notified choices. Families need to ask regarding settlement frameworks and potential concealed prices, making certain that they are completely prepared for the economic dedications in advance.
Tips for Transitioning Your Loved One to Assisted Living
Shifting a loved one to assisted living can be a tough process, as families should navigate a wide variety of emotions and practical considerations. To facilitate this adjustment, it is important to include the enjoyed one in the decision-making process whenever feasible, enabling them to reveal their choices and issues. Familiarizing them with the brand-new environment before the relocation can additionally alleviate stress and anxiety; check outs and conferences with staff can develop a feeling of convenience. Loading individual things that hold sentimental value can aid make the new area really read more feel even more like home. Furthermore, developing routine interaction and visiting routines can provide emotional support. Participating in area tasks can cultivate social links and promote a smoother modification to the assisted living community.
